Language & Literacy
Character Portrait
BRING BACK
- Ask your child to think of a favorite book character.
- Read a book with that character in it.
- Have your child draw or paint a portrait of the character, with a setting from the book in the background.
- Ask your child to describe their character portrait, and to explain why they drew the character and the background that way.
Math
Marching to 10
- Invite your child to march with you as you count to 10 together.
- Show your child how to march and march around a few times together.
- Now march and count each step with your child until you count to 10.
- Invite your child to lead the counting.
Physical
We’re Stuck
- Tell your child that you will play a game where you will pretend to be stuck in different locations.
- “We’ll pose and hold still to act it out.”
- Suggest different scenarios, such as pretending to be under a table, stuck in a small box, stuck to sticky chewing gum as you try to walk, and stuck with your hands in the air.
- Take turns with your child to lead the game and suggest different scenarios.
